RFR: 8319117: GrowableArray: Allow for custom initializer instead of copy constructor [v2]

> When using at_put and at_put_grow you can provide a value which will be supplied to the constructor of each element. In other words, you can intialize each element through a copy constructor.
>
> I suggest that we also provide a function equivalent where the function is provided a pointer to the memory to be initialized. This can be used for `NONCOPYABLE` classes, for example.
>
> This is implemented using a SFINAE pattern because `nullptr` introduces ambiguity if you use static overload.
